Output bf8e386fd6c44e6dcbbe94d4e42e347d4d7b2d6f39fe438916fa672b9078fe28:1327

value
501420
script pubkey
OP_0 OP_PUSHBYTES_20 708f5862600c9a47a9ea1e193ea2a9e68d5f2ff1
address
tb1qwz84scnqpjdy0202rcvnag4fu6x47tl3ekgc7l
transaction
bf8e386fd6c44e6dcbbe94d4e42e347d4d7b2d6f39fe438916fa672b9078fe28
confirmations
15475
spent
false

1 Sat Range